Installation: PLANTA project with Jira
Requirements
The following requirements apply to the use of PLANTA project with Jira:
- PLANTA project must be installed (at least DB 39.5.15)
- Jira Server or Jira Cloud must be installed
- PLANTA link must be licensed.
- PLANTA Jira link must be licensed
Settings
To enable the integration of PLANTA project with Jira, the following settings must be made:
- PLANTA Server
The following Webservice environment variables for the PLANTA project system that is to communicate with the Jira system must be configured in the manager container of the PLANTA server:
webservices__generic_service__enable- must be activated (true)webservices__generic_service__interface- must be configured if necessarywebservices__generic_service__port- must be configuredwebservices__ssl_generic_enable- must be activated (true) if you wish to run Jira on HTTPS.webservices__apikey_auth_filter_generic- must be deactivated (false) because Jira does not authenticate itself to the web interfaces.
Once the configuration is done, you have to restart the server.
- PLANTA link
- Define the required parameters in the Jira authentication area in the Jira Parameters module and select the required interfaces in the Jira interfaces area.
- In PLANTA standard, all required standard interfaces are already stored by default.
- Synchronize or link PLANTA project and Jira users in the User Synchronization module.
- Define the required parameters in the Jira authentication area in the Jira Parameters module and select the required interfaces in the Jira interfaces area.
- PLANTA project
- Time Recording Variant = 3 must be preset to enable the transfer of hours worked recorded in Jira to PLANTA project.
- At the moment the interface does not support automatic reverse postings. This means:
- you can either use the Reverse Posting Variant = 0 reverse posting setting. However, this setting does not prevent changes from being made on the part of Jira (this would require adjustments to be made in Jira), the changes will simply not be transferred to PLANTA project.
- or you can generally work without reverse postings (no key date, no release for records transferred to external systems, etc.)
Note
- Since the integration with Jira is based on web interfaces, please also observe the notes on web interface configuration.